Tucked away in North Dakota's heartland, Lisbon invites visitors to tee off at the scenic Bissell Golf Course or catch a performance at the historic Opera House. Families can enjoy a picnic at Sandager Park before taking a short drive to explore the natural beauty of nearby Fort Ransom State Park.

Best time to go to Lisbon

The best time to visit Lisbon is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with no r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Lisbon

Traveling to Lisbon, North Dakota, is convenient via two major airports. FARgo Hector International Airport (FAR) is 83.7km away, with nearby hotels like the Radisson Blu Fargo, located 4.8km from the airport, and DoubleTree by Hilton West Fargo, 9.7km away. Both offer transportation services for easy access. Alternatively, Jamestown Regional Airport (JMS) is 93.3km from Lisbon, with hotel options such as My Place Hotel and Baymont by Wyndham, both 4.8km from the airport. These hotels provide convenient access to the airport, ensuring a smooth travel experience.

What's the seasonal weather like in Lisbon?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 68°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 18°F. The snowiest months in Lisbon are April, March, December, and February, with each month seeing an average of 10 inches of snowfall.
